Dynamically allocate ata_channel info; introduce custom atadrive_s struct.
Don't limit the number of ATA controllers supported - just dynamically allocate the structs. Create an atadrive_s struct that extends the standard 'struct drive_s' and have the new struct store a pointer to the ata channel info. Also, prefer storing drive_s pointers as 32bit "flat" pointers - adjust them as needed in the 16bit code.
